Output 8396fa94287b6eba4bd34b5b99e82fee37a77d3f1f1d3bf0357e2fe311386974:0

value
505389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6494133fa75a45fdba267ee561af0d78ea2f0b OP_EQUAL
address
3BPa3BuTRFWdZX7ytGjhae3wZ5zLu8rb2p
transaction
8396fa94287b6eba4bd34b5b99e82fee37a77d3f1f1d3bf0357e2fe311386974
spent
true